How they compare
Myanmar currently reports 49.2% against 48.7% in Côte d'Ivoire, a difference of 0.5%.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Myanmar ahead.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 25th and Myanmar ranks 24th of 186 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Côte d'Ivoire averaged higher in 1 and Myanmar in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d'Ivoire | Myanmar |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 51.9% | 68.8% | 17.0% | Myanmar |
| 2000s | 51.2% | 58.5% | 7.2% | Myanmar |
| 2010s | 51.7% | 53.5% | 1.8% | Myanmar |
| 2020s | 50.6% | 49.8% | 0.7% | Côte d'Ivoire |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
